La requête ci-dessous permet d'avoir un état des lieux de toutes les clés étrangères toutes tables confondues pour une base de données MySQL. Par défaut sous phpMyAdmin il n'est évident de retrouver cette information bien qu'il soit possible de lister les clés étrangères en utilisant la vue relationnelle au niveau d'une table. Notez que vous devez utiliser le moteur InnoDB pour pouvoir créer des clés étrangères sous MySQL. La requête utilise le schéma d'information MySQL de la base de données afin d'en extraire les clés étrangère s. Clé étrangère phpmyadmin project page. Il vous suffit de remplacer 'database_name' par le nom de votre base de données dans la requête:
SELECT * FROM INFORMATION_SCHEMA. TABLE_CONSTRAINTS WHERE ` table_schema ` LIKE 'database_name' AND ` constraint_type ` = 'FOREIGN KEY';
Il peut être utile d'obtenir cette liste lorsque vous avez besoin de supprimer toutes les clés étrangères d'une base de données pour effectuer des changements de structures sur certaines tables. Pour rappel vous pouvez supprimer une clé étrangère en utilisant son identifiant interne via cette requête:
ALTER TABLE ` table_name ` DROP FOREIGN KEY ` table_name_foreign_key_ibfk_1 `;
Navigation
- Clé étrangère phpmyadmin
- Clé étrangère phpmyadmin wiki
- Clé étrangère phpmyadmin project page
- Sirop végétal du massif de chartreuse.fr
- Sirop végétal du massif de chartreuse francais
Clé Étrangère Phpmyadmin
MySQL supprime certaines clés étrangères
(8)
Comme expliqué here, semble que la contrainte de clé étrangère doit être supprimée par le nom de la contrainte et non par le nom de l'index. La syntaxe est: alter table footable drop foreign key fooconstraint
J'ai une table dont la clé primaire est utilisée dans plusieurs autres tables et a plusieurs clés étrangères à d'autres tables. Clé étrangère avec phpmyadmin [Résolu]. CREATE TABLE location (
locationID INT NOT NULL AUTO_INCREMENT PRIMARY KEY... ) ENGINE = InnoDB;
CREATE TABLE assignment (
assignmentID INT NOT NULL AUTO_INCREMENT PRIMARY KEY,
locationID INT NOT NULL,
FOREIGN KEY locationIDX (locationID) REFERENCES location (locationID)... ) ENGINE = InnoDB;
CREATE TABLE assignmentStuff (...
assignmentID INT NOT NULL,
FOREIGN KEY assignmentIDX (assignmentID) REFERENCES assignment (assignmentID)) ENGINE = InnoDB;
Le problème est que lorsque j'essaie de supprimer l'une des colonnes de clé étrangère (ie locationIDX), cela me donne une erreur. "ERREUR 1025 (HY000): Erreur lors du changement de nom" Comment puis-je supprimer la colonne dans le tableau d'affectation ci-dessus sans avoir cette erreur?
Clé Étrangère Phpmyadmin Wiki
Développeur informatique contrarié...
09/04/2011, 10h54
#3
Envoyé par vorace
Merci beaucoup pour ton aide. Alors, j'ai fait comme tu m'as dit pour la création des 2 indexes, c'est-à-dire PANIER_NUM et CLIENT_LOGIN, dans la partie "Structure" de ma table mais je n'ai pas bien compris pour la partie "Gestion des relations". J'ai bien quelque chose dans la partie "Relations internes" (IENT_LOGIN) mais je n'ai rien sous Foreign Key (InnoDB) ni "ON DELETE" ni "ON CASCADE", donc est-ce qu'il faut indiquer quelquechose sous "Foreign Key"? [MySQL] Comment créer une clé étrangère avec phpmyadmin? - PHP & Base de données. 10/04/2011, 10h26
#4
Ca y est j'ai trouvé!! En faite, il faut ajouter une clé unique dans la partie "Structure de la table" au niveau de la ligne de la clé étrangère. Je m'explique: au moment de créer la table, on cret la clé primaire en cochant la case "PRIMARY". Ensuite, c'est pareil quand on insère la clé étrangère, sauf qu'on doit cocher la case "UNIQUE". Quand on a fini de créér sa table, on valide. Puis on va dans "gestion des relations" dans la page de la table, on a à côté de la clé étrangère une colonne "Relations internes" puis une colonne "Foreign Key (Innodb).
Clé Étrangère Phpmyadmin Project Page
En cliquant sur ce lien, la page affichée offrira la possibilité de créer un lien vers une autre table pour n'importe quel champ (la plupart). Seules les CLÉS PRIMAIRES y sont affichées, ce qui fait que si le champ relié n'est pas affiché, c'est que quelque chose ne va pas. Le menu déroulant en bas est le champ qui va être utilisé comme le nom pour un enregistrement. Database - Comment créer une clé étrangère dans phpmyadmin. Exemple de vue relationnelle ¶
Admettons qu'il y ait des catégories et des liens, et qu'une catégorie puisse contenir plusieurs liens. La structure de la table devrait ressembler à:
tegory_id (doit être unique)
_id
tegory_id. Ouvrir la page de vue relationnelle (sous la structure de table) pour la table link et pour le champ category_id, en sélectionnant tegory_id comme enregistrement maître. En suivant le lien de table, le champ category_id sera un hyperlien cliquable vers l'enregistrement de catégorie correct. Mais tout ce qui est affiché est seulement category_id, pas le nom de la catégorie. Pour corriger cela, ouvrir la vue relationnelle de la table category et dans le menu déroulant en bas, sélectionner « nom ».
La figure suivante vous indique où cliquer:
Il est alors possible d'ajouter des références pour l'attribut numLivre (1) et de spécifier comment cette contrainte s'applique sur la suppression d'un enregistrement ou sur la mise à jour d'un enregistrement(2). Phpmyadmin vous propose d'ailleurs les attributs pouvant être référencés (1). Sur notre exemple, nous avons tous les attributs de chaque table qui ont été déclaré comme appartenat à la clé de la table et dont le type est le même que celui de numLivre (c'est-à-dire int). Il nous suffit donc de choisir l'attribut codeBarre de la table Livre. Comme vous pouvez le voir il est possible de référencer un attribut de la même table: numLivre pourrait référencer numClient. Clé étrangère phpmyadmin wiki. Dans notre exemple de bibliothèque cela n'a aucun sens. Mais imaginez une table employé qui stocke l'ensemble des employés d'une société et dont les attributs sont (numEmployé, nom, prénom, chef). Le chef d'un employé étant lui même un employé, il est alors pratique de pouvoir faire un lien entre l'attribut chef et l'attribut numEmployé afin de spécifier que le chef d'un employé est obligatoirement un employé.
Débarrasser l'intestin de ces hôtes indésirables permet non seulement de voir disparaitre des symptômes désagréables (et parfois anodins), mais cela améliore également l'efficacité de l'absorption des nutriments. Et cela, c'est très important. Notre appétit peut ainsi se stabiliser, nous débarrassant au passage de quelques kilos superflus. Je vous invite à faire cette cure en famille (eh, oui, mieux vaut que tout le monde soit à la même enseigne! Massif de Chartreuse en questions-réponses pour vos visites, vacances et voyages - Live Love Voyage - Your Travel Guide. ) grâce au sirop végétal du Massif de Chartreuse. Rassurez-vous, je n'ai aucune action chez Sopharm, le labo du produit. Ce sirop contient: de l'extrait de matricaire, de citronnelle, de fenouil, de romarin, de cannelier, de houblon et de marjolaine. Protocole d'utilisation:
Il est conseillé de prendre le sirop végétal du Massif de Chartreuse le matin à jeun, 3 jours de suite. pour les enfants de 3 à 13 ans: 2 cuillères à café
pour les enfants de plus de 13 ans et aux adultes: 2 cuillères à soupe
Il est vivement recommandé de refaire une cure de 3 jours 20 jours plus tard.
Sirop Végétal Du Massif De Chartreuse.Fr
L'Équinoxe d'automne aura lieu le 22 septembre 2016. L'automne en médecine traditionnelle chinoise, c'est la saison du poumon et du gros intestin. C'est le moment idéal pour faire une petite cure anti-parasite qui va faire du bien à vos intestins. Je la conseille à la plupart de mes clients. Sirop du massif de chartreuse | Géobiologie-santé. En effet, rares sont celles et ceux qui viennent me voir et sont exempts de petits vers intestinaux, oxyures et ascaris notamment. Il fut une époque, avant les années 60, où l'on faisait ce nettoyage régulièrement. Malheureusement, de nos jours, les parasites sont devenus les parents pauvres de la médecine. Et pourtant, ces parasites microscopiques – on ne les voit pas à l'œil nu, même si l'on observe attentivement ses selles dans la cuvette des toilettes- peuvent provoquer des troubles chroniques, mineurs la plupart du temps, mais bien embêtant tout de même:
toux,
problèmes digestifs,
manque de concentration,
pertes de mémoire,
problèmes nerveux,
insomnies inexpliquées,
petites crises allergiques,
poussées de fièvre sans raison.
Sirop Végétal Du Massif De Chartreuse Francais
… », '5: Les Jardins et Château du Touvet. …', '6: Les Grottes de Saint-Christophe. …', '7: Le Musée Arcabas en Chartreuse. Sirop Végétal du Massif de Chartreuse 200ml | Pas cher. ' Une dizaine de plantes cueillies en Chartreuse Selon les années, une dizaine d'espèces sont ramassées, dont les bourgeons de hêtre, l'alchimie, le plantain, la reine des prés, les pissenlits, les fleurs d'églantiers, les millepertuis et les bugles. Concernant les habitantes (filles et femmes) de Saint-Pierre-de-Chartreuse vous utiliserez le terme de Chartroussines. Servir idéalement fraîche entre 12° et 13° ou sur glace. Utilisée comme ingrédient de cocktails ou en cuisine dans des recettes sucrées ou salées depuis le 19e siècle, elle apporte un caractère unique. De même, un encart commercial de 1929 stipule également que grâce à sa composition et à ses vertus, l'élixir végétal de la Grande Chartreuse est: « souverain contre les indigestions, maux d'estomac, syncopes, influenza, choléra et mal de mer. »
La chartreuse verte est très herbacée et dégage des notes de menthe, poivre, anis, citron et gingembre.
Épinglé sur Products